Thread Starter | Logic 8 Bug? Does this happen to you? Has anyone else experienced Logic "secretly" changing some of the preferences, settings and key commands? It happened to me twice after some big crashes from heavy sessions. All of a sudden things don't work the same- the "Software Monitoring" check box is unchecked, "C" starts toggling my metronome instead of the cycle (after I set it and used it that way for months), and a lot of other mysterious things change... Any ideas why this is happening? ALSO- does anyone know why my Arrange window solo and mute buttons started functioning independently of my mixer and inspector??? I mute a track in the arrange window, but the mute button on it's channel strip doesn't show it's muted (even though you can't hear the track anymore). It happened to me once before and I can't remember how I solved it. I think it's some setting you can change somewhere. HELP! ![]() Thanks! |

It is in your User library and is named com.apple.logic.pro.plist Re: the solo behavior, it is in the preferences>audio> general. The behavior you are seeing is with CPU-saving (slower) so change it to Faster (remote channel strips) and it will be consistent. Personally, I would rather they be independent.
